Output 780e31cbd544ef2031dd7fe6b1daf6de471094f95197647a435c04d49eed1b6e:1

value
63606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c81d716408ee434a06251760072ed655bb2ed0d OP_EQUAL
address
32q9aJLpK1TrkZyGsjMwMfPgS61YVsEs5i
transaction
780e31cbd544ef2031dd7fe6b1daf6de471094f95197647a435c04d49eed1b6e